Comprendre la Blockchain: les concepts clés

Comprendre la Blockchain 1/3: les concepts clés

La technologie de la blockchain est une innovation avec le potentiel de perturber le monde tel que nous le connaissons actuellement, où nous avions déjà étudié ses potentielles utilisations dans cet article. Cependant, comprendre la blockchain est encore un défi pour beaucoup de personnes tandis qu’apparaissent de nombreuses limitations à surmonter pour les entreprises voulant l’exploiter.


Les smart contracts


Plus encore que le stockage distribué des données, les smart contracts sont le socle fonctionnel de la blockchain et donc la base de son application en entreprise. Ils sont à la fois la force et la faiblesse de la technologie, avec en leader Ethereum.


Il est bon de rappeler que la domination d’une plate-forme de smart contracts dépend de la sécurité de ses contrats intelligents. Des recherches sont en cours dans la communauté Ethereum sur les langages et les outils permettant de construire des contrats intelligents plus sûrs, mais tant que ces technologies ne seront pas déployées à grande échelle, les contrats Ethereum resteront vulnérables aux attaques. De même, l’évolutivité est essentielle au succès d’Ethereum. Des innovations clés, telles que la preuve d’enjeu, le sharding, les chaînes latérales et le calcul hors chaîne sont en cours de recherche et développement, mais avec encore des mois et des années de déploiement.


Parallèlement, des plates-formes concurrentes, également à divers stades de développement, innovent en matière de langages, de mise à l’échelle, de sécurité, de gouvernance et de facilité d’utilisation. Ils testent des protocoles consensuels hautement évolutifs, de nouveaux paradigmes de gouvernance décentralisée et d’autres avancées prometteuses. Ils ont l’avantage de tirer les leçons de l’expérience d’Ethereum tout en commençant proprement sans milliards de dollars en jeu. Dans la plupart des cas, leurs efforts ont été bien financés par les ICO.


Comprendre la blockchain: definition

La Blockchain est un cas particulier de Registre distribué (DLT). Elle utilise des blocks comme mécanisme de sécurité pour garantir l’intégrité des données et leurs échanges à travers un protocole peer-to-peer. Pour que les transactions soient validées et disponibles les pairs doivent s’entendre sur l’état de la Blockchain. Les transactions sont dites atomiques et durables dans le sens où la Blockchain a vocation à être ineffaçable.

image transaction blockchain
Cycle de vie d’une transaction Blockchain — Crédit Futurs.io


Un des premiers défis pour les organisations qui souhaitent s’aventurer sur le chemin de cette technologie est de choisir la bonne blockchain pour leur cas. Pour éclairer ce choix, Notre article revient sur les grandes notions de cette technologie tout en décrivant les use cases déjà éprouvés.

Vous pouvez consulter l’article détaillé sur notre Medium.


By Mathieu Weill

Et aussi...
>Tous les articles